The Reasons To Use A Dog Cone Collar

Canine injuries and surgery require protection against the damage caused by biting, licking and scratching at the wound site. Additional irritation delays healing processes and increases the risk of infection that will need additional antibiotics and treatment. A dog cone collar is an affordable and simple way to stop pets from reaching the areas that require the proper levels of healing.

Where injuries have developed on the face and body, it is important that canines do not reach these regions that can prove difficulty in regular management. Canines can benefit from natural intervention and supportive strategies that prevent licking, scratching or biting the affected area. Where owners cannot remain around their pets on a 24 hour basis, the use of these types of collars can prove most beneficial.

There is the option of buying cones in its paper or plastic form possessing the lampshade design that is fit around the neck of dogs and prevents against further complications. These items are temporary support devices and assist in maintaining the healthy condition of operated sites where infection can occur. An experienced veterinarian must be consulted to determine effective healthcare solutions for all types of pets.

A vet will advise on the use of cones after surgery is performed to protect the area from being damaged and provide sufficient time to heal. Implementing the proper processes can assist in enhancing regular function of all animals and minimize the deterioration that is expensive and time consuming to tend to. The proper management methods will assist in determining effective solutions to maintain healthy and balanced pets.

Dogs are required to make use of an E collar including a paper base or harder plastic shell according to specific sizes. Cardboard may be best for canines of a smaller size and plastic should be provided for larger pets of a heavier size. These steps will prevent the cones from becoming severely damaged and keep the areas best protected from additional irritations.

These types of collars must be provided to dogs with positive levels of reinforcement and fit securely without causing additional discomfort. The specific plastic collars will fit around the neck and secure the head limiting the ability for the dog to shift and reach the target regions. All canines should be slowly introduced to the collars with reinforcement to minimize stressful experiences.

The traditional cones placed around the neck of dogs are important to minimize further damage to the injured and operated sites. The proper steps can tend to canine healthcare requirements with affordable measures and ensure that pets are provided the chance to recover without additional complications. All forms of support must be carefully assessed by an experienced veterinarian for the best results.

The traditional E collars remain a popular choice to keep dogs well protected and ensure that all pets are secured. Reliance on a qualified veterinarian can determine the most applicable supports that ill prevent dogs from reaching the affected sites. The proper steps can assist in finding protective measures to ensure that canines remain happy and healthy.
